🌿 Backed by Research: Why Puzzles Are Good for the Mind

The mental health benefits of puzzles aren’t just anecdotal.
Studies published in Frontiers in Aging Neuroscience show that mentally stimulating activities, like therapeutic puzzles, help support memory and cognitive function as we age.
Research from the University of Michigan finds that solving puzzles improves visual-spatial reasoning, short-term memory, and even boosts mood.

Best of all, puzzling offers a unique path to flow state — that deeply immersive experience described by Mihaly Csikszentmihalyi, where time slips away and only the present moment matters.

💛 Puzzle as Therapy: Healing for the Mind and Senses

At PERMA, we believe puzzles aren’t just exercises for the mind — they’re nourishment for the heart.

Many therapists now use puzzles with clients experiencing anxiety, ADHD, grief, or depression. Why? Because puzzles:

  • Offer tactile and visual stimulation
  • Build resilience through small, meaningful wins
  • Create quiet moments of reflection
  • Encourage mindful play and grounded presence

In East Asia, adult puzzles are often recommended as part of sensory therapy and emotional recalibration — a way to return to self, piece by piece.
